A study exploring midwives' education in, knowledge of and attitudes to nutrition in pregnancy.

作者信息

Mulliner C M, Spiby H, Fraser R B

出版信息

Midwifery. 1995 Mar;11(1):37-41. doi: 10.1016/0266-6138(95)90055-1.

Abstract

OBJECTIVE

to explore midwives' education in, knowledge of and attitudes to nutrition in pregnancy.

DESIGN

survey using questionnaire and interview schedule.

PARTICIPANTS

a randomly selected sample of 77 Registered Midwives.

SETTING

one English regional health authority.

MEASUREMENTS AND FINDINGS

qualitative and quantitative data collection methods. Midwife teachers were responsible for 95% of teaching in nutrition. 86% of midwives had received no education in nutrition following qualification. 46% of midwives achieved a poor score in nutrition knowledge. Considerable numbers of midwives felt unprepared to offer dietary advice to women from ethnic minority groups (36%), vegetarians (66%) and to women with pre-existing medical conditions (41%).

KEY CONCLUSION

midwives require more education in nutrition both during basic education and following qualification. IMPLICATIONS FOR EDUCATION PRACTICE: nutritional issues should be included in continuing education programmes available to qualified midwives.
